P4 KBU is a 2015 Renault Trafic in Black with a 1,598c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 10 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 80%.
Across all 2015 Renault Trafic models, the average MOT pass rate is 73.7% with a typical mileage of 81,054 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Renault Trafic fails its MOT is track rod end ball joint has excessive play, accounting for 87,451 recorded failures. If you're considering buying P4 KBU,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Renault Trafic typically stays on UK roads for around 37 years. At 11 years old, this Renault Trafic is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
